Ask the Experts

Bob Rogers

Chief Technology Officer and Founder. Application Matrix

Bob 'Mister' Rogers has more than twenty-five years of storage, systems, and performance management experience. Mr. Rogers is presently Chief Technology Officer and founder of Application Matrix, a startup focusing on Information Lifecycle Management (ILM) and Business Process Management (BSM) tools. At BMC Software, he was Chief Storage Technologist of the Storage Division. As Chief Architect at SOFTWORKS, he orchestrated the development of storage software for heterogeneous platforms and was instrumental in leading the company through its 1998 IPO and EMC's $192 million dollar acquisition in 2000. Mister Rogers led several of IBM's product introduction programs including ADSM (now the Tivoli Storage Manager), HSM, and DFSMS (IBM's Systems-Managed Storage) prior to joining SOFTWORKS. Mr. Rogers is a prolific writer, speaker, sought-after consultant in his field, and one of the founding members of SNIA's ILM Technical Working Group.
